The NA055CP0 is a thin-section radial ball bearing with a 5.5″ bore and 6″ outer diameter, featuring a compact 0.25″ width. Made from chrome steel with a brass cage, it offers durability and smooth operation.
It handles radial loads up to 685 lbf and fits within ABEC-1 tolerance standards. The open design allows easy lubrication, while the chromium plating adds extra corrosion resistance.
This bearing is interchangeable with KAYDON models, making it a practical choice for replacements. Ideal for applications like robotics or precision machinery where space is limited.
Weighing just 0.25 lbs, it’s lightweight yet sturdy. Compliant with RoHS standards, it operates in temperatures from -30°C to 110°C.
